Where can you see the Black-headed Cuckooshrike?
Some of the best places to see the Black-headed Cuckooshrike in the wild include Kanha Tiger Reserve (India), Bandhavgarh National Park (India) and Bandipur National Park (India) — among 15 wildlife hotspots across India and Sri Lanka.
